Approximating Your Fixing Spending Plan



Approximating your repair budget calls for a cautious evaluation of both the instant costs and possible unexpected expenditures. Begin by gathering quotes from neighborhood professionals. These initial price quotes will certainly provide you a standard for the job required.

Look carefully at the products and labor prices, as these can differ dramatically in between providers.

Next, take into consideration the age and condition of your roofing system. If it's aging, you could intend to factor in the opportunity of additional repairs that could occur once work begins. For instance, hidden damage may be found once the roof shingles are gotten rid of, causing increased prices.

It's wise to set aside an additional 10-20% of your allocate these unexpected issues.

Don't forget to consist of any necessary authorizations or examinations in your budget. These can add to your total expenses however are vital for conformity and safety.
